Commit Graph

  • 055f993522 csfix Simon Groenewolt 2020-11-07 16:50:08 +01:00
  • 36f03643f3 Rename guesstimatePublicFolder() to getPublicFolder() and make the function protected. This way subclasses of Kernel can provide their own implementation, for example returning a hard-coded path. Simon Groenewolt 2020-11-07 16:09:34 +01:00
  • fdb266d60f View homepage in Editor even if viewless Ivo Valchev 2020-11-05 16:07:07 +01:00
  • 1cf9c13e31 Merge branch 'master' into feature/copy-link-to-clipboard Bob den Otter 2020-11-08 16:20:32 +01:00
  • c9540a5f63 csfix Ivo Valchev 2020-11-05 14:13:43 +01:00
  • 9d0fc2e23f Prettier filemanager. Fix minor UX issue with what is displayed Ivo Valchev 2020-11-05 14:12:03 +01:00
  • 3ff7fc1ecd csfix Ivo Valchev 2020-11-05 10:17:03 +01:00
  • c898037921 More compact filemanager, go back icon, test fixes Ivo Valchev 2020-11-05 09:58:31 +01:00
  • 8710d53e42 Add tests + labels Ivo Valchev 2020-11-04 17:05:23 +01:00
  • bf08a0f5d0 CSRF Ivo Valchev 2020-11-04 14:09:03 +01:00
  • cd7b44f853 Filemanager create/delete folder actions Ivo Valchev 2020-11-04 14:06:17 +01:00
  • 1351386f0f Replace Faker with fork, since original is abandoned Bob den Otter 2020-11-07 13:33:07 +01:00
  • 869208df51 Update .editorconfig Bob den Otter 2020-10-31 14:50:39 +01:00
  • 3b2e6d9b83 Correct setting Bob den Otter 2020-10-31 14:42:43 +01:00
  • 1b178e95aa Fix: Support standard Symfony .env options Bob den Otter 2020-10-31 13:59:49 +01:00
  • be80abb830 Fix: in getTaxonomies(), return early when we don't have "Content" Bob den Otter 2020-11-06 13:15:26 +01:00
  • 1d7b577e5f Merge pull request #2105 from bolt/bobdenotter-patch-3 Ivo Valchev 2020-11-06 09:40:22 +01:00
  • 141580d72b Copy link to clipboard in filemanager Ivo Valchev 2020-11-05 15:37:00 +01:00
  • b3d1241ae6 Explicitly set form_theme for when a project defines its own forms. Bob den Otter 2020-11-05 13:59:53 +01:00
  • 18cd816cff Merge pull request #2097 from Wieter/fix-404-emptyimage Ivo Valchev 2020-11-04 14:32:55 +01:00
  • d23579f7a2 fix for: TypeError: Cannot read property 'key' of undefined, when accessing http://localhost/bolt/edit/54#media Wytse Talsma 2020-11-03 17:04:03 +01:00
  • a82e8c4fa1 simpler fix, still undefined in L30 Wytse Talsma 2020-11-03 17:46:01 +01:00
  • 4b90c00cb1 fix for loading 'null' images #2079 Wytse Talsma 2020-11-03 16:30:42 +01:00
  • 7e021f012b undoing all from 50e6f1b, more errors further down appear Wytse Talsma 2020-11-03 21:32:50 +01:00
  • 59cb0f4325 strange git Wytse Talsma 2020-11-03 17:53:16 +01:00
  • d820383b67 simpler fix, still undefined in L30 Wytse Talsma 2020-11-03 17:50:51 +01:00
  • cacfc764e0 simpler fix, still undefined in L30 Wytse Talsma 2020-11-03 17:46:01 +01:00
  • 6f45775767 Show filelist and imagelist in a card Ivo Valchev 2020-11-03 15:37:59 +01:00
  • c0a053e3eb Add switch example to showcases Ivo Valchev 2020-11-03 14:37:35 +01:00
  • 579a53a6fe Readonly checkbox + switch option Ivo Valchev 2020-11-03 14:37:14 +01:00
  • 58c52a0b7a Add switch example to showcases Ivo Valchev 2020-11-03 14:37:35 +01:00
  • 36629ec434 Readonly checkbox + switch option Ivo Valchev 2020-11-03 14:37:14 +01:00
  • 16f316872f Correctly instantiate fields in prod Ivo Valchev 2020-11-03 10:58:59 +01:00
  • 74ce3feda8 Correctly instantiate fields in prod Ivo Valchev 2020-11-03 10:58:59 +01:00
  • f4ed587a29 Searchable relations Ivo Valchev 2020-11-03 16:33:43 +01:00
  • a912e114b1 Merge branch '4.1' Bob den Otter 2020-11-03 17:05:00 +01:00
  • 50e6f1baf2 fix for: TypeError: Cannot read property 'key' of undefined, when accessing http://localhost/bolt/edit/54#media Wytse Talsma 2020-11-03 17:04:03 +01:00
  • 6ec51bd2dc fix for loading 'null' images #2079 Wytse Talsma 2020-11-03 16:30:42 +01:00
  • b024a5ccd0 Merge pull request #2 from bolt/master Wieter 2020-11-03 15:01:40 +01:00
  • c3621d6a01 Merge branch 'simongroenewolt-feature/server-side-validation' Bob den Otter 2020-11-02 20:07:16 +01:00
  • 5aa2be4da2 Prepare release 4.1.5 4.1.5 Bob den Otter 2020-11-02 17:03:30 +01:00
  • feeccc9fb6 Merge branch 'master' into feature/server-side-validation Bob den Otter 2020-11-02 19:05:25 +01:00
  • 029c251ac9 Merge branch 'simongroenewolt-feature/server-side-validation' Bob den Otter 2020-11-02 19:04:28 +01:00
  • 627abd1040 Update record_listing.feature Bob den Otter 2020-10-31 17:57:01 +01:00
  • 9015003b6b Update ContentTypesParserTest.php Bob den Otter 2020-10-31 17:23:54 +01:00
  • ee43c112bc move validation demo content type to the end to fix tests Simon Groenewolt 2020-10-30 12:18:22 +01:00
  • 64d15f983c revert change to preview action Simon Groenewolt 2020-10-25 22:53:07 +01:00
  • 6dc001b711 Hint to default disable validation before merging Simon Groenewolt 2020-10-25 22:10:19 +01:00
  • 7fceb16873 Explicitly configure Bolt\Validator\ContentValidator as the implementation of the Bolt\Validator\ContentValidatorInterface that should be used Simon Groenewolt 2020-10-25 22:08:00 +01:00
  • c36eda2b37 csfix Simon Groenewolt 2020-10-24 20:34:00 +02:00
  • 7826abba16 update collection fields so they are usable immediately after processing the save action -- data was only correct after a load from the db (needed for validation, and to not 'lose' a new field when validation errors occur) Simon Groenewolt 2020-10-24 20:26:09 +02:00
  • 48fc8509b2 'relationship' -> 'relations' (old name was taken from form field naming, but seems less fitting) Simon Groenewolt 2020-10-24 17:01:30 +02:00
  • b466c5c696 fix validator_options lookup in config Simon Groenewolt 2020-10-24 17:00:27 +02:00
  • b5c7690d7b csfix Simon Groenewolt 2020-10-23 22:54:34 +02:00
  • 8a76961edf disable validator by default, enable via config Simon Groenewolt 2020-10-23 22:47:47 +02:00
  • 5c2d7a0432 collections validation work in progress (not perfect yet) rename 'limit' to 'count_constraint' -> limit is in use by the js of the admin interface (collection select new item dropdown) Simon Groenewolt 2020-10-23 22:32:25 +02:00
  • e5f95fd1c9 moved demo validation to separate content type Simon Groenewolt 2020-10-23 13:03:12 +02:00
  • 01679209bc add 'flash' to indicate error saving Simon Groenewolt 2020-10-23 13:02:45 +02:00
  • ac04ae0b57 fix in correct handling of (set) fields that have no constraints specified Simon Groenewolt 2020-10-23 13:01:52 +02:00
  • 08715ce78b csfix Simon Groenewolt 2020-10-19 23:34:36 +02:00
  • 32c29ad3a9 Constraints for collections! Simon Groenewolt 2020-10-19 23:32:56 +02:00
  • 78149e3d59 Constraints inside sets work Simon Groenewolt 2020-10-19 21:35:47 +02:00
  • 0c83856cb9 DemoContentValidator -> ContentValidator, as it is really not a demo anymore but a nearly complete implementation. Simon Groenewolt 2020-10-19 21:10:38 +02:00
  • d63891304b example limit on 'multiple' relation makes more sense Simon Groenewolt 2020-10-17 22:23:29 +02:00
  • 274ff3f46d handle/update content and relation objects the 'doctrine way' by updating both sides of the relation when saving. Simon Groenewolt 2020-10-17 22:20:05 +02:00
  • 2b292d4cdc support limit (Count Constraint) on relations Simon Groenewolt 2020-10-17 13:36:36 +02:00
  • 29b709dc14 add inversedBy on Relation fields Simon Groenewolt 2020-10-15 15:11:34 +02:00
  • 852f76e7f9 forgot about cscheck again. Simon Groenewolt 2020-10-15 13:27:55 +02:00
  • 5e2de18b74 Allow actual constraints on fields. (only checking showcases for now, relations and taxonomy are still 'fake') Simon Groenewolt 2020-10-15 13:14:47 +02:00
  • 41e10c624a coding standards fixes - now we are not specific on return type, as it's not possible to express what we allow in the current version of php (I think) Simon Groenewolt 2020-10-04 23:41:40 +02:00
  • 8505291538 coding standards fixes - now we are not specific on return type, as it's not possible to express what we allow in the current version of php (I think) Simon Groenewolt 2020-10-04 23:40:19 +02:00
  • 72d34a67eb coding standards fixes Simon Groenewolt 2020-10-04 23:15:43 +02:00
  • 286dd247a5 updated validation example to include fields, taxonomy, and relations Simon Groenewolt 2020-10-04 23:03:21 +02:00
  • 81e5316058 - add validator interface - inject in controller and call if available (small refactor to limit code duplication in ContentEditController.php) - show errors in editor, not linked to fields yet - DemoContentValidator.php shows how to manually validate (demo only, should not be included into bolt) Simon Groenewolt 2020-10-02 23:59:49 +02:00
  • 99d8d0a7ec Whitespace has gone missing again! Bob den Otter 2020-11-02 18:41:51 +01:00
  • 1916742133 Merge branch '4.1' Bob den Otter 2020-11-02 16:53:54 +01:00
  • 3f6fde0eb3 Fix empty Imagelist breaking rendering in Prod ENV Bob den Otter 2020-11-02 08:42:29 +01:00
  • d254315a21 Don't break installation if no SQLite is present Bob den Otter 2020-10-31 14:34:00 +01:00
  • 3f9049cc70 Don't break installation if no SQLite is present Bob den Otter 2020-10-31 14:34:00 +01:00
  • b7317e3567 Update 1_Bug.md Bob den Otter 2020-11-01 13:13:06 +01:00
  • e897887e85 Update record_listing.feature Bob den Otter 2020-10-31 17:57:01 +01:00
  • 4f6af7042b Update ContentTypesParserTest.php Bob den Otter 2020-10-31 17:23:54 +01:00
  • ac734573e7 Update UploadController.php Bob den Otter 2020-10-31 10:50:59 +01:00
  • a0bbb0aaf5 Update UploadController.php Bob den Otter 2020-10-31 10:50:19 +01:00
  • dd711f8313 cleanup Ivo Valchev 2020-10-15 11:14:39 +02:00
  • 47b45d1821 Add translation. csfix Ivo Valchev 2020-10-15 11:12:55 +02:00
  • c1b4ddd900 Upload image from URL works Ivo Valchev 2020-10-15 10:59:19 +02:00
  • 3c6e1a1ce2 Upload image by url Ivo Valchev 2020-10-14 16:09:16 +02:00
  • 2526a0f178 Nothing to see here... not telling phpstan to keep it quiet Ivo Valchev 2020-10-22 11:26:48 +02:00
  • f18756eff1 cleanup Ivo Valchev 2020-10-15 11:14:39 +02:00
  • f5737b7b2f Add translation. csfix Ivo Valchev 2020-10-15 11:12:55 +02:00
  • 0db5949a71 Upload image from URL works Ivo Valchev 2020-10-15 10:59:19 +02:00
  • f64c72d158 Upload image by url Ivo Valchev 2020-10-14 16:09:16 +02:00
  • ffa5eb844d Use first element, regardless of index Bob den Otter 2020-10-31 10:40:56 +01:00
  • 838d551e2a Make "files" selector use more levels Bob den Otter 2020-10-28 17:09:05 +01:00
  • 972670f02c Merge branch 'bugfix/default-locale-on-main-pages' Bob den Otter 2020-10-30 17:13:05 +01:00
  • 9fca4e9f6a Merge branch 'master' into bugfix/default-locale-on-main-pages Bob den Otter 2020-10-30 17:12:27 +01:00
  • a29ec8e6c2 Correct spelling of sup Bob den Otter 2020-10-30 12:29:44 +01:00
  • 46011e7112 move validation demo content type to the end to fix tests Simon Groenewolt 2020-10-30 12:18:22 +01:00
  • cf12b0bf00 😚🎶 Bob den Otter 2020-10-29 17:37:19 +01:00